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ather necessary tools and materials.
  • Ensure the vehicle is in a safe and well-ventilated area.
  • Disconnect the negative battery terminal.
2. Battery Inspection and Replacement
  1. Inspect Battery Condition

    • Check for cracks or leaks in the battery casing.
    • Clean the terminals with a wire brush and a mixture of baking soda and water.
    • Tighten terminal connections.
  2. Test Battery Voltage

    • Use a multimeter to measure the voltage. If it’s below 12.4 volts, consider replacement.
  3. Replace Battery (if necessary)

    • If the battery is faulty, remove it by unbolting the battery hold-down clamp.
    • Lift the battery out carefully.
    • Install a new, compatible battery, ensuring it is firmly seated and connected correctly.
3. Address Parasitic Draw
  1. Perform Parasitic Draw Test
    • Reconnect the negative terminal and set the multimeter to measure amps.
    • Remove fuses one at a time to identify which circuit is causing the draw.
    • Investigate and repair any faulty components in the identified circuit.
4. Final Checks
  • Reconnect all components and ensure all electrical systems function properly.
  • Reinstall any fuses removed during testing.
